    Would've been 3 stars with the super extra delivery time (80 minutes!?). But the food hit! The nachos with chicken, for $9, were made with freshly fried chips and heaps sour cream, Oaxaca cheese, and guacamole. Hella bang for your buck! Plus the flavors were authentic- no tacky cumin or canned beans. Fresh chips are a HUGELY noteworthy addition, and the chicken was charcoal-y and moist as you can get. Pork Carnitas Burrito ($9) was also super legit at a generous serving. The Carnitas were some of the best I've had! Crusty outside, juicy center. Salty and a liiiitle spicy. Such a damn good burrito. The rice was tender but not "yellow" so much as "off-white". As a Cali Girl, I also wish I had a choice of beans (obvi refried), but the black beans were fine. With awesome prices and dope servings, this'll be my new go-to for Mexican. Just that I'll plan on my order taking almost 90 minutes!?

    4 earned stars. Locally run not some food chain franchise like the vomitable taco-bell garbage. The steak quesadilla is big! You can choose between 3 sorts of tortilla. Its like twice the size of a quesadilla in Chelsea. Taste was great! Not stuffed with an overload of cheeze speckled with beef because of some profit margin This is BEEF filled with a nice thin cheese layer. Just Perfect. Meat is tender. Not one chewy greasy bit! The chicken tacos are stuffed with lettuce and veggies and big sized. Cheaper and double the size than the fancy overpriced stuff in the city. Overall happy this place is one block away from me. Nice personnel, SUPER CLEAN venue. And Celia Cruz on the speakers while i wait. Thanks!

    This was the first time ordering from here. A co-worker and I order lunch: the Chorizo quesadilla, Grilled Chicken Sandwich, Grilled Chicken Taco and Grilled Veggie Panini. We wanted to try different dishes as this was our first time ordering. The chorizo quesadilla was terrible. There was barely any chorizo, the quesadilla tasted cold and was not grilled and at all. My co-worker enjoyed the veggie panini. She loves meat and wanted to try something different. For a meat lover, she definitely raves about how delicious it was. The Chicken Taco was phenomenal. It tasted so fresh and the grilled chicken was well seasoned. Lastly, the grilled chicken sandwich was good too. The sandwich actually appeared in a wrap and not on bread, but otherwise it tasted great. The sauces were a great blend. We highly recommend the grilled chicken taco and veggie panini:)
